Abstract
Albumin was glycated (nonenzymatically glycosylated) with glucose; fru ctose, galactose, ribose or glycerardehyde for 5, 9, 15 and 19 days. T he extent of glycation was determined (a) by the thiobarbituric acid m ethod, (b) by fructosamine assay, (c) by method based on the reaction with hydrazine, and (d) by measurement of fluorescence. Results show t hat the three colorimetric methods used differ in the sensitivity and in addition with the use of each method not the same extent of glycati on with various sugars was found.
